Method

Preparation of Ingredients

1

Roast the Peach

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C). Cut the peach in half, remove the pit, and place it cut-side up on a baking sheet. Roast for 15-20 minutes until tender and slightly caramelized. Allow to cool, then scoop out the flesh and set aside.

2

Prepare the Butternut Squash

Peel and cube the butternut squash into 1-inch pieces. Boil in salted water for about 10-12 minutes or until fork-tender. Drain and let cool slightly before mashing or blending into a smooth puree.

Mixing the Cocktail

3

Combine Ingredients

In a cocktail shaker, combine the Probitas Rum, aged rum, Benedictine, roasted peach flesh, butternut squash puree, and lemon juice. Add ice to the shaker.

4

Shake

Shake vigorously for about 15-20 seconds until well chilled.

5

Strain

Strain the mixture into a chilled cocktail glass. You can use a fine mesh strainer to ensure a smooth texture.

Garnishing

6

Garnish

Garnish your cocktail with fresh mint leaves on top. Optionally, you can add a small slice of roasted peach on the rim for extra flair.
